Installing libseat from Official repos (community) gives error

Following this post, I tried installing wlroots and xdg-desktop-portal-wlr from repos. libseat is dependency for wlroots, but trying to install it gives error:

Checking integrity...
Error: libseat: signature from "Brett Cornwall <brett@i--b.com>" is unknown trust
Failed to commit transaction:
invalid or corrupted package

I tried changing mirrors, but error still remains. Is it safe to install this package? Should i try to stop pacman from checking ?

Brett’s key expired. Look this thread Maintainer pgp keys expired

This command should work:

sudo pacman -U https://repo.ialab.dsu.edu/manjaro/stable/community/x86_64/libseat-0.5.0-2-x86_64.pkg.tar.zst
